  5. T

    Cat 257B skid steer maint ???s

    daily you NEED to grease the three fittings on each side of the undercarriage for the pivots for the torsion springs, they need grease as much as the bucket pivots, the manual should give you all the hours that things need to be change,we do oil with samples every 250 hours and change all...

  10. T

    Landscape rake. Anyone use one?

    we have the same rake your looking at, it isn`t bad but the material has to be dry and if it is too soft, it will collect LOTS of dirt, as for speed, ther recommend like 1 to 2 miles per hour in REVERSE , if your doing a big area it can seem to take forever, but it is nice when your done.

  13. T

    Before I find out the hard way..

    if your going up a steep hill keep the boom/arm stretched out and low to the ground, then if you slip you can grab the ground with your bucket and stop, and if it is steep and your going down hill i put the boom about half way out and low to the ground, same deal if it starts to tip forward you...
